Yeemz

yeemz (Yi-Mei Templeman) creatively fuses genres in order to welcome people of all backgrounds into her distinctly intimate and emotive storytelling. yeemz is a cellist, singer-songwriter, and composer from Santa Monica, California. She is currently classical cellist in-residence at the New England Conservatory with her internationally acclaimed piano trio (and best friends), Trio Gaia. She has been writing songs on the piano from a young age, but only began experimenting with singing and playing her cello like a guitar in 2018, when she was unable to bring her ukelele to college with her. Since then, yeemz has quickly established the roots of a uniquely multi-faceted career, performing around the world as a classical cellist, producing her own music, recording and arranging strings for other artists, scoring music for film, and teaching cello students of all ages. yeemz orchestrates her original songs with her own cello playing and draws songwriting inspiration from literature, indie-folk influences, and classical music alike. She has music out on all streaming platforms, and has been featured on multiple Spotify editorial playlists. She will soon release the first single from her debut album. The single, “TSA”, is inspired by yeemz’s real life experience leaving water in her bottle going through TSA and also by themes from Bell Hooks’ book, “All About Love”.
